Front Tracking and the Interaction of Nonlinear Waves
Abstract
The research program has emphasized innovative computations and theory. The computations and theory support and enhance each other. A coherent approach was used which depends upon abstracting important mathematical concepts and computational methods from individual applications to a wide range of applications involving complex continua, including wave refractions, flows in elastic and plastic media, and complex fluid mixing. Adaptive computational methods were developed for flows with discontinuities and implemented on modern parallel computers.
